FAQ
Is Timber Twist: Nuts & Loops free to play?
Yes, the game is free to download and play. It may include optional in-app purchases for hints or to remove advertisements. The core puzzle experience is available without any cost.
Does the game require an internet connection?
No, Timber Twist can be played offline once downloaded. An internet connection is only needed for initial installation or if you choose to purchase optional items. This makes it perfect for travel or areas with limited connectivity.
How many levels are in the game?
The game includes a large number of levels that gradually increase in complexity. While the exact count may vary with updates, there are enough puzzles to provide many hours of engaging gameplay without repetition.
Can I play this game on a tablet?
Absolutely. Timber Twist is optimized for both phones and tablets. The touch controls scale well to larger screens, and the visual clarity of the wooden pieces is enhanced on a bigger display, making it even more enjoyable.
Are there any time limits or penalties?
No, there are no time limits or penalties for making mistakes. Players can take as long as they need to solve each puzzle. This relaxed approach is central to the game's design, reducing stress and encouraging thoughtful problem-solving.
Is the game suitable for young children?
Yes, the game is designed for all ages. The early levels are simple enough for young children to understand, and the colorful wooden theme is appealing. Older children and adults will find the later puzzles sufficiently challenging. It's a great tool for developing spatial reasoning skills.
